UPDATE: Teens killed in 3-car Wheeling crash from same high school

WHEELING (WBBM NEWSRADIO) - We’re learning new information about a northwest suburban crash that left four teenagers dead Tuesday night.

High School District 214 said in a statement that the four teenagers who were killed in the crash, and one teen who was injured were all students at Buffalo Grove High School. The teens who were killed were 16 to 18 years old, according to police. The crash happened around 10:20 p.m. at Dundee and Schoenbeck Roads in Wheeling. Police said several people had to be extricated from the three vehicles involved

Police said speeding and driving through a red light were primary factors in the crash. The district offers its thoughts and prayers to the families and friends of the students involved.

Buffalo Grove High School is closed today because of a fire Tuesday night, but counselors will be made available as soon as possible to help the school community deal with its loss.
